All streams
Search
Write a publication
Pull to refresh
36
0
Send message
На днях выкатим соответствующую главную страницу, сейчас доверстываем.
Да, достаточно правильно указать вес — впрочем, начиная с cuttlefish, вес ставится автоматически в зависимости от размера диска.
Смотрели на этапе выбора, но у нее довольно конские лицензионные условия и очень мало информации по опыту применения в открытом доступе.
Свой дистрибутив с базой на debian stable.
Нода — физический сервер. Виртуалки, безусловно, потеряют исполняемое состояние если нода «сгорит», то есть станет недоступной моментально, в этом случае они будут запущены заново в других местах автоматически. Аппаратный отказ подразумевает все иные классы событий — битая память, умерший бп, перегревающийся до троттлинга процессор и так далее.
Гм, скорее нет — гластер настолько отстает в плане производительности, что делать сравнение равносильно принятию инвалида в грузчики по программе equal opportunities. Можно было бы сравнить Glusterfs и Cephfs — здесь первая, несомненно, впереди по ряду факторов, но это решение для очень узкого набора задач и, боюсь, практически никому не будет интересно.
Можем ответить для масштаба стойки — примерно 110 терабайт с учетом трехкратной репликации, то есть 350 «сырых».
Если говорить о, допустим, трех стойках, RF=3 и одной вылетевшей, то латенси устаканится примерно за минуту. Данные, безусловно, доступны на чтение и на запись сразу после пересчета расположения новых primary копий(что в масштабе 500тб будет занимать 5-10 секунд).
<тут был комментарий мимо ветки>
Нет, это как раз из области bad practices, мы упомянули об этом в статье.
RDMA транспорт будет в обозримом будущем, но он не дает большого прироста на обычных операциях — уменьшается задержка, связанная с TCP стеком и соответствующая нагрузка на процессор, в современных системах тоже достаточно скромная удельно.
К сожалению, тут вкралась неточность — не degraded, a recovering, т.е. восстанавливающийся в настоящий момент времени объект. Такой объект будет восстановлен с наибольшим приоритетом, потому что состояние recovering блокирует операции из-за возможного изменения положения primary копии.
DDR/10GigE стоят в пределах десятипроцентной разницы столько же. В пределах стойки разница вообще не заметна.
Для рекавери. Без свойства автоматического восстановления применять кластерную фс в публичном облаке нельзя.
Gluster является стабильным, в каком-то понимании, но не производительным. К тому же, во время выбора решения гластер не обладал ни драйвером в qemu, ни кворумом.
Как мы отметили, роли compute и storage совмещены.
Говорится, что не так и все очень плохо (с)
ТС, а что за нестандартные операции над серверами имеете ввиду?
Скоро все будет. Мы заканчиваем ряд важных исправлений и изменений, потребность в которых увидели после публичного запуска, как только закончим — начем растить клиентскую базу. Полагаю, это произойдет до конца месяца.

Дело в том, что в отличие от веб-проектов мы не можем позволить себе править технологические решения при большой клиентской базе. Все что закладывается сейчас, останется с нами навсегда, поэтому спешка тут неуместна.

Information

Rating
Does not participate
Registered
Activity